Assuming you are canadian and therefore only have the right to work in Canada, then I hate to be the one to break it to you but there are MANY pilots in the same position as you! Do you really think that any small operator is going to spend money to advertise a job for low timers?
You have 2 choices : instruct, or get in a car and drive. Yellowknife would be a good target, but you are already too late for this year...
My first job was way north of 60, and I'm lucky I got it. I went there to get it. We had guys phoning everyday looking for a job, and some even flew up... I know guys that drove across the country 3 times before they found something.
